Legitimate to introduce children to value for money. But even though his intentions are good, often You do various errors when teaching children about money. If it is not too aware, can-can the child will not get the message that you want to convey. Here are some the mistake is often made when parents introduce children about the value of money:
1. give an example of wrong.
This error may be most aware of when doing so. You teach your child to save money and not spend money to buy goods that are not needed. So often You forbid children to buy toys that are of interest in the mall, on the pretext they didn't need it. But it turns out You own fun shopping-Shopping clothes, DVDs, magazines, or whatever you want. Should have as a parent, You exemplify it about the right money management is not only limited to mere speech."The ban without clear examples of parents to make children become confused, because it goes against. Better explained by giving an example of a right, "says Eileen Gallo, PhD, author of the Silver Spoon Kids: How Successful Parents Raise Responsible Children.
2. it is difficult to differentiate the needs and desires.
There is no harm if you bought something that was sorely needed. However, this is different from what we want. When parents are difficult to distinguish where the needs and desires, then the child is also no longer be able to distinguish the two. For example, a shoe designer who became the favorite of output You are discounted at half price. You "gave up" and buy it. Defeat You finally make you buy these shoes make you won't learn how to reject the new status symbols such as a discount.
"Children also need to learn that buy goods not needed-even though it is discounted at-also in fact also a waste. Due to the fact that money can be used to buy other essentials, "shot Paul Richard, Executive Director of the Institute of Consumer Financial Education in San Diego.
3. always save a child's fault.
When learning to manage money, children must often make a mistake. For example, when given the allowance for a week, usually they are difficult to manage it so its not up to a week is up. Oftentimes You feel sorry for the kids, because they can not buy anymore because his money runs out a snack. Compassion makes you tend to save him from error, so that the child does not learn from his mistakes. Preferably, let children feel the trouble could not because no more spending the money he has.
"If You always save the children when they do not manage money well, they're not going to learn about how to manage money and they won't feel the result of a mistake he made. This will be an important lesson about life according to their ability, "says Ann Douglas, author of Family Finace: The Essential Guide for Parents.
4. Appreciate everything with money.
Your Pernahkan everything that is done is rewarding children with money? If Yes, stop doing it. Never gave him money in return for everything that it should do, such as making PR. don't give her a reward in the form of a sum of money when he managed to get good grades in the class, or after helping you do your homework. If You do, you will fail to deliver the right motivation to work hard and learn a maximum of at school. In addition, the child receives is not satisfaction that comes with doing their best to achieve that goal, but to get a lot of money from you.
5. using money as a substitute for time and attention.
Working all day to meet all the needs of the household is commonly done by men and women. However, this causes an imbalance in domestic life. For those of you busy, often the child is not getting enough attention. To overcome this, you generally will give you some money and let them choose all of the things they want to keep them happy and no whining ask for your attention.
For you, this is the most practical way to demonstrate a sense of caring, and as a substitute for togetherness with her family. But this is wrong. be aware you that no one else in the world-even money though-and valuable to You than with Your love and attention?
